Most plants use the C3 pathway for carbon fixation. However, some plants, such as sugar cane, corn, and cacti that grow in hot conditions, use alternative pathways to fix carbon and conserve energy loss due to photorespiration. Photorespiration is the process that occurs when the oxygen concentration is high. Under such conditions, the rubisco enzyme in the Calvin cycle binds O2 instead of CO2, which halts photosynthesis and consumes energy.

Auditory pathways constitute the complex neural circuits responsible for transmitting and interpreting auditory information from the peripheral auditory system to the brain. Sound waves are initially captured by the outer ear, funneled through the ear canal, and reach the tympanic membrane (eardrum). These vibrations are transmitted via the middle ear's ossicles to the inner ear's cochlea.

Area of Science:

  • Healthcare policy
  • Medical education
  • Public health

Background:

  • China aims to significantly increase its general practitioner (GP) workforce, targeting 300,000 by 2020.
  • This initiative involves developing and utilizing multiple GP training pathways.

Purpose of the Study:

  • To comprehensively illustrate the various strategies and pathways employed in China for training general practitioners.
  • To provide an overview of the existing models for GP education and development in the country.

Main Methods:

  • Descriptive policy analysis was employed to examine GP training in China.
  • An inventory of relevant literature and source documents was compiled.
  • A model was developed to visually represent the different pathways for training general practice physicians.

Main Results:

  • Multiple training pathways exist, including the rural doctor pathway, the 3+2 pathway for assistant GPs, a transfer pathway for current physicians (1-2 years), and the 5+3 pathway (5 years bachelor's + 3 years residency).
  • Training duration and depth vary significantly, from 2-year technical degrees to doctorates.
  • Advanced degree programs have seen limited utilization.

Conclusions:

  • China's GP training landscape is characterized by significant heterogeneity.
  • The 5+3 pathway shows strong potential for enhancing GP quality and achieving future workforce goals.
  • China has set a new target of 500,000 additional GPs by 2030, emphasizing quality improvement.
